I found out something today that I thought I would pass along to the members here. I received a few 5.45x39 AR-15 mags from AIM Surplus today. Aim had sold them as ASC mags which stands for (Ammo Storage Component), however when they arrived they had AR Stoner floor plates on them and ASC no-tilt followers. So thinking I got the ole bait and switch I decided to call AIM and ASC. It turns out that ASC makes a lot of different mag for a lot of different people and my mags should have gone to another vendor but due to a shipping mistake wound up at AIM instead. So, just in case your reading the web for reviews as I have and seeing reports of ASC mags being good mags and AR Stoner being junk, well, now you know the rest of the story....there all the same. Even my beloved Grendel mags are made by ASC.
